What causes panic attacks? When we are too anxious, it exposes us to panic attacks because it is among the many reasons of panic attacks. Although it is normal, and a bit healthy to become mildly anxious from time to time, substantial exposure to things that can result to anxiety is very stressful to our system. So once the stress is there, it will now cause panic attacks.

This condition may also be due to hereditary issues. Different studies relates heredity to panic attacks but though it still lacks scientific clarifications, it is probable. In fact, when you try to trace the genetic tree of those agonizing from the condition, you will see that there are one or two members of your keen that has the same condition.

The place and the people you are exposed to are also a big part in determining whether you will or will not have the illness. When you have a history of a violent home atmosphere, you are more prone to the disorder. Other than family life, a stressful work place will also be a reason for panic attacks.

The kind of character that you have will also determine whether you are vulnerable to the illness. Again, anxiety and too much stress will result to panic attacks; so holding back all the bad feelings inside yourself will also put you at risk for this disorder. Lack of ability to communicate all the feelings hidden inside will surely boil down to a disorder in the future.

A personal loss may also ignite your panic attacks. This is such a stressful event because you lost something that you love and treasure. This is most particularly true when that person or job you lost will significantly affect not only your present but also your future. If you just overlook the root cause of the stress, then it may result to a panic or anxiety attack.
